MingREZ.8.10.2023 <br /> SHAWN & STEPHANIE CHING <br /> CHANGE OF ZONE APPLICATION NO. PL-REZ-2023-000044 <br /> CONDITIONS OF APPROVAL <br /> A. The applicant(s), its successor(s), or assign(s) ("Applicant") shall be responsible <br /> for complying with all of the stated conditions of approval. <br /> B. The Applicant shall maintain valid water commitments to support the proposed <br /> development until such time that required water facilities charges are paid in full. <br /> C. Prior to issuance of Final Subdivision Approval, the Applicant shall construct <br /> necessary water improvements meeting with the approval of the Department of <br /> Water Supply. <br /> D. All earthwork and grading activity shall conform to Chapter 10, Erosion and <br /> Sedimentary Control of the Hawaii County Code. <br /> E. All driveway connections and construction within the Old Mamalahoa Highway <br /> and Waokele Street right-of-way shall conform to Chapter 22, County Streets, of <br /> the Hawaii County Code. Access to Old Mamalahoa Highway and Waokele <br /> Street, including the provision of adequate sight distances, shall meet with the <br /> approval of the Department of Public Works, Engineering Division. <br /> F. All development-generated runoff shall be disposed of on site and not directed <br /> toward any adjacent properties. A drainage study shall be prepared by a licensed <br /> civil engineer and submitted to the Department of Public Works (DPW). Any <br /> recommended drainage improvements, if required, shall be constructed meeting <br /> with the approval of DPW prior to issuance of Final Subdivision Approval. <br /> G. The method of sewage disposal shall meet with the requirements of the State <br /> Department of Health. <br /> H.
